WHARTON v. WHARTON

No. 5-235.

424 So.2d 458 (1982)

Jane Flick, Wife of Frank W. WHARTON v. Frank W. WHARTON.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, Fifth Circuit.

December 9,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Frank W. Wharton, in pro. per.

George L. Gillespie, Jr., Gillespie & Jones, Metairie, for plaintiff-appellee.

Before CHEHARDY, KLIEBERT and CURRAULT, JJ.


KLIEBERT, Judge.

The trial judge made a judgment for past due child support and alimony of $6,341.50 executory against the husband, Frank W. Wharton, and awarded attorney fees of $400.00 to the wife's attorney and costs, including a fee of $320.00 to the attorney appointed by the court to represent the husband when his original counsel withdrew.
